أكثر "Try it Yourself" الأمثلة أدناه.
تعريف والاستخدام
و confirm() يعرض طريقة مربع حوار مع رسالة محددة، جنبا إلى جنب مع OK وزر إلغاء الأمر.
وكثيرا ما يستخدم مربع تأكيد إذا كنت تريد المستخدم للتحقق أو قبول شيء.
ملاحظة: يأخذ مربع تأكيد التركيز بعيدا عن الإطار الحالي، ويجبر المتصفح لقراءة الرسالة. لا تكثر من استعمال هذه الطريقة، كما أنه يمنع المستخدم من الوصول إلى أجزاء أخرى من الصفحة حتى يتم إغلاق مربع.
و confirm() بإرجاع طريقة صحيحا إذا قام المستخدم بالنقر فوق "OK" ، وكاذبة خلاف ذلك.
دعم المتصفح
طريقة | |||||
---|---|---|---|---|---|
confirm() | نعم فعلا | نعم فعلا | نعم فعلا | نعم فعلا | نعم فعلا |
بناء الجملة
confirm( message )
قيم معلمة
معامل | اكتب | وصف |
---|---|---|
message | String | اختياري. ويحدد النص لعرض في المربع تأكيد |
تفاصيل تقنية
قيمة الإرجاع: | A منطقية، تشير إلى ما إذا "OK" أو "Cancel" تم النقر في مربع الحوار:
|
---|
مزيد من الأمثلة
مثال
عرض مربع تأكيد، وإخراج ما قام المستخدم بالنقر فوق:
var txt;
var r = confirm("Press a button!");
if (r == true) {
txt =
"You pressed OK!";
} else {
txt = "You pressed Cancel!";
}
انها محاولة لنفسك » مثال
مربع التأكيد مع فواصل الأسطر:
confirm("Press a button!\nEither OK or Cancel.");
انها محاولة لنفسك » صفحات ذات صلة
كائن نافذة: href="met_win_alert.html"> alert() Method
كائن نافذة: href="met_win_prompt.html"> prompt() Method
<كائن النافذة